At TE, you will unleash your potential working with people from diverse backgrounds and industries to create a safer, sustainable and more connected world. Job Overview TE Connectivity's Machinist Team's responsibilities include, assignment planning, layout, set up, operating and making tool adjustments for various types of manual, numerically controlled and computerized machine shop equipment. They work from blueprints, process sheets and sketches to perform production tasks, which may include the cutting and shaping of metal to precision dimensions, communicating directly with engineers to understand the purpose of a part assembly. Every team member is responsible for maintaining housekeeping and organization of the work area as well as following TE Connectivity's EH&S policies and procedures. Key Responsibilities:

Adhere to all safety requirements and wear required PPE at all times in production areas

Ensure raw material availability and promptly communicate any shortages to the team leader

Verify that workstations are properly identified and in good condition

Update the Hydra system with production data as per the defined sequence

Start, restart, and shut down presses as needed

Record mold history information

Complete production report cards

Perform visual inspection of molded products using appropriate measuring equipment

Maintain cleanliness and order in assigned areas following the 5S+1 standard

Enter setup parameters into injection molding presses based on mold requirements

Perform TPM walkarounds and complete the process control sheet

Continuously monitor the process and check for leaks or process deviations

Package finished products according to the packing process sheet, including weigh counting

Complete all required documentation related to production, scrap, downtime, issues (Factory Order log), maintenance requests, and labor reporting

Troubleshoot process-related issues

Apply SMED during mold changeovers

Train new operators and ensure proper onboarding to operational standards
